|
没猜错的话,应是AMI BIOS。
在redbee的帖子http://bbs.wuyou.net/forum.php?mod=viewthread&tid=205532的
第35#有图片。
--------------------------------------------------------------
这跟“BIOS 从此不再以各种 CHS 手段来耍流氓了”没关系,
主要牵扯一个问题:
U盘是设成固定盘设备(盘号80h,DOS C:),还是设成移动盘设备
(盘号00h,DOS A:),BIOS该如何判定计算。
------------------------------------------------------------------
LZ把U盘设成Force HDD(也就是BIOS你也别算了,强制指定盘号80h,给我按硬盘
处理),后续的流程,BIOS当然要以LBA方式处理。
------------------------------------------------------------------
Auto不是LZ说的U盘格什么是什么,AMI BIOS主要看2个前提条件:
1、容量是否>530MB
2、U盘移动介质位/固定介质位属性
根据这2个条件确定U盘该被识别成何种设备。
------------------------------------------------------------------------
所谓的格式化成FDD/HDD/ZIP,有点扯淡。
前面说了“U盘是设成固定盘设备,还是移动盘设备,BIOS该如何判定计算”。
一般情况下,U盘格式化成什么格式(比如MBR的情况),并不是BIOS关注的“第一”
重要因素。
BIOS关注的“第一”重要因素是什么呢? 是:容量(总扇区数)。
AMI BIOS,Phoenix BIOS都是如此。
其他重要因素有:
1、移动介质位/固定介质位的情况(可以通过量产工具修改),
2、U盘是否支持ZIP专用命令,返回码情况。
这些内容都是要通过USB命令,从U盘固件那获取。而不是读MBR之类的方式获取。
-------------------------------------------------------------------------
当然,有些版本的BIOS本身提供特殊选项:强制不考虑上面说的“第一”重要因素。
像AMI的force FDD,force HDD。这属于“非常规”的情形了。
[ 本帖最后由 wuwuzz 于 2012-6-17 18:29 编辑 ] |
|